Description
Drowning in the solitude of her failures, she lay, bound tightly by the grasp of her fear. Fear of what she does not know, what she has not tried, what she cannot be.It's talons clutching at her, she struggles to the surface, she must break free. Her dreams of hope, happiness and light burning at icy grip ofthe past. Ever striving onwards, she struggles towards that dream, her freedom.

This piece was made using photoshop 6. The idea of the picture is about becoming overwhelmed by your failures and gaining the strength to finally break free and keep going. It's an idea I've had for some time now and only now have I gotten around to completing it.
This took around 3 days to complete, on/off whilst chatting and battling to get onto the computer with my brother.
To be honest I've never really enjoyed doing a piece as much as I have this one. It may not be well recieved by others, I'm not sure, but I definately enjoyed making it and learning from it. I think it might have something to do with the personal meaning it holds for me, and hopefully something I can look back at when I get my grades back in February should it not turn out so well!
This was made using a combination of reference pictures, tutorials (for the stars) and my imagination.

One good critique deserves another - - - you have a lot of talent, and your work specifically with faces is exceptionally good - - - - however, your skills with developing an environment need a little work... here in particular, the water rippling around her appears blurred - almost as if its fog. And the sky has a wee bit too much detail - especially that one section where it looks like there's a meteor storm going on. But keep at it - - - you have all the talent, and with a few more pieces, you will definitely have some pretty awesome pieces!
